About The Position

The University of Windsor is seeking Recruitment Advisors to share information about the student experience, admissions and awards policies, student support & services, and the application process with prospective students, their supporters, and educators, both virtually and in-person. This role supports undergraduate student recruitment and engagement by representing the University at events, responding to inquiries, and providing information on admissions, services, and student life. Responsibilities include assisting with outreach activities, campus visits, CRM record management, and reporting.
